They are similar yes, But Neil is alot more proven in both his Fighting and Scoring. Neil is a willing fighter, he buzzes looking for hits, he'll take on anyone regardless of mismatch, he also can put up consistant points. Neils 2m contract is a reflection of Ottawa not wanting to give him up, His FA Value isn't/wasn't 2m. It's more or less in the 1.5-1.8 range. Moen's toughest competition last year was Boll and Fedoruk. In the Boll fight he faired well they were both swinging for the fences, But against Fedoruk he got himself handed to him, But in all fairness he dropped the gloves to fight Jovo, but Fedoruk got in the middle of things. Overall, Neil will fight heavies and will do well, where as Moen is a LHW fighter at best, but fights has been fighting Middleweights and Relative Non Fighters more so then Heavies. Which isn't a bad thing, heavies are a thing of the past, But the intimidation factor would be lacking. You take into account that Moen isn't the same physically as Neil, That deducts some $$, You take out the fact that Moen was only a 20 point getter ONCE in his career, Where Neil has been Three times. I can see Moen getting a slight raise from last years 900k contract, Maybe into the 1.2m range. But with alot of teams already spending there money, Moen might have to take less on a 1 yr just to prove himself.. IMO.
